Belgian Tervuren vs Pudelpointer

People compare Belgian Tervurens and Pudelpointers because they’re both athletic, brainy dogs built for serious work, and they look vaguely similar at a glance. medium to large, wiry-coated, always alert. But their souls? Totally different. If you’re choosing between them, you’re really deciding between a precision instrument and a Swiss Army knife. The Tervuren is pure focus. Bred to guard flocks under pressure, it lives for its job and its person. It’s the breed that will lock eyes with you in a crowded park and still obey a hand signal. Five stars for trainability, but that intensity cuts both ways. It needs structure, consistency, and a job. fast. Without it, you’ll get reactivity, anxiety, or destructive boredom. It’s not the dog you casually take to doggy daycare or leave with the sitter every weekend. And while it loves its family, it’s not a cuddle puddle. Affection is earned, not given freely. The Pudelpointer, on the other hand, is a hunting omnivore. bred to track, point, retrieve on land and swim through cold water with that water-resistant coat. It’s smart and trainable, yes, but with a softer, more adaptable edge. It bonds deeply with the whole family, will fetch the kids’ balls for hours, and actually enjoys crashing on the couch after a long day in the field. It’s more forgiving of life’s hiccups. your vacation, a new apartment, a change in routine. Here’s the real talk: if you’re not hunting or doing advanced dog sports multiple times a week, the Tervuren will likely frustrate you. But if you are? The Pudelpointer might just be the most versatile, joyful partner you’ll ever take afield.
